Transaction 8dcbac91c6e3acf7d3d8aeb26be2509818891a5f9e617c638971eedd63f43821
1 Input
1 Output
-
8dcbac91c6e3acf7d3d8aeb26be2509818891a5f9e617c638971eedd63f43821:0
- value
- 259038
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3bd9100c1cc69a5023bf743ab7ec22130632f45a OP_EQUAL
- address
- 379TpeAEJSF4Xvgao6BHfSQ1QwCEJWrL2b